The main benefits of a sports remedial massage would include: improving performance, reduces muscle soreness and stiffness, and can help speed up the recovery time after a minor injury, especially if used with a rehabilitation program. Usually, a sports massage will concentrate on the specific muscles used during a particular sport.
Pre-event sport massage can be beneficial in enhancing athletic performance and preventing injuries by improving blood flow, flexibility, and muscle readiness. However, its effectiveness may vary depending on individual needs and preferences. It is recommended to consult with a qualified sports massage therapist to determine the best approach for each athlete.
There really are no specific guidelines for working on minors that is different in Sports Massage that is different than any massage. The minimum age is generally considered to be 16 or over. If you are working on someone 15 or under, there should be a parent or guardian present during treatment.

It generally takes 1,000 hours of training and passing the National Certification Exam in Sports Massage given by the AMTA. That would take about one to two years of training.

Ice massage is usually called ice friction massage and involves the use of ice in cryotherapy as part of sports massage. It is useful in the lowering of inflammation and the relief of pain from injuries and overuse.
